> > One gripe I had with Grails is that it's ActiveRecord style
> > persistence.  That's as expected, of course, but I'm not a fan.  It's
> > simple to wrap up with DAO-style persistence to hide the fact.  I'm
> > also not much of a fan of scaffolding, because you invariably end up
> > having to customize, and then you can't regenerate without losing the
> > customizations.  You can go crazy with your scaffolding templates to
> > mitigate some of the issue, but it's still hard to get it all right.
>
> > All that said, for getting something out the door quickly it's awesome.
